Maine lawmakers land airport habitat bill after turbulent takeoff

Maine lawmakers reconvened this week to salvage a bill that would relax habitat protections around airports after drawing criticism from aviation officials and wildlife advocates alike for amending the bill beyond recognition. Members of the Environment and Natural Resources scrapped that previous version of the bill, L.D. 138, at a Wednesday work session, voting unanimously to swap blanket exemptions for all municipal developments with new lang…
